Misha Koshelev <mk144210@bcm.edu> writes:
> This sends proper position information to the GDI driver when we are emulating these functions.
I don't think I agree with this one. If the driver needs to update the
position then it should implement ArcTo etc. since it may need to
distinguish that from an explicit MoveTo. Or if the generic
implementation is really good enough in all cases then we shouldn't
export a driver entry point at all.
